There is a famous saying which perfectly describes integrity. “Honesty is telling the truth to other people, integrity is telling the truth to myself.” The word ‘integrity’ itself has a Latin origin. It is derived from the word ‘integer’ and means to feel whole, i.e. a complete person. So it refers to the sense of completeness and togetherness one enjoys when they live their lives honestly and morally. So a person that has integrity will act and behave as per set values and believes they hold dear. Let us explore this concept more in this integrity essay.

Academic Integrity

Academic integrity refers to the ethical policies and moral code employed in the academic world by all members – the students and the teachers. So as we saw previously in this integrity essay, it involves being honest and doing the right thing even if you get no recognition for doing so. It involves being honest and correct when no one is watching.

Academic integrity is important to lay down a good foundation for the student, so he can follow the same principles for the rest of his life. Integrity leads to trust-building among colleagues and friends. It is also the sign of a good future leader. It is a good habit to develop early in your life, it will hold you in good stead as you progress in your life.

So basic things like doing your own homework, writing your own papers, not plagiarizing your essays or dissertations, not cheating on home tests, never cheating on any assignments, and generally doing your work ethically and honestly are the all essential. They are the building blocks of academic integrity.

Professional Integrity

Next, we shall explore professional integrity in this integrity essay. As we know, integrity is one of the essential value an employer always seeks in his employees. So professional integrity is when a person adopts his values and integrity to his chosen profession and job.

Sound moral and ethical beliefs and basic honesty are highly valued characteristics in an employee. Such an employee behaves morally with his co-workers, his superiors and all other stakeholders of the organization.  Acting with integrity and honesty is an actual advantage in the workplace. It builds trust and people are drawn towards such honest and dependable behavior. Integrity in a workplace also promotes a positive environment which encourages higher productivity.

Integrity is often described as the quality of being honest, truthful, and morally upright. It is the alignment of one’s actions, values, and principles with unwavering honesty and consistency. Integrity is not merely a set of rules but a way of life that guides individuals in making ethical decisions.

The Significance of Integrity

Integrity is the bedrock upon which trust, credibility, and ethical conduct are built. It is the foundation of strong relationships, both personal and professional, and plays a crucial role in fostering a just and harmonious society.

Trust and Credibility:

Integrity is the bedrock of trust. When individuals consistently uphold their values and principles, their actions become predictable and reliable. This reliability forms the basis of trust in personal relationships, professional collaborations, and societal institutions.

Strengthening Relationships: Integrity strengthens the bonds between individuals. Honest and transparent communication, a fundamental aspect of integrity, fosters deeper connections, enhances empathy, and promotes open dialogue in both personal and professional relationships.

Ethical Leadership: Integrity is a defining characteristic of effective leaders. Leaders who embody integrity inspire trust and confidence in their followers. They lead by example, setting high ethical standards for their teams and organizations, thus contributing to the growth and success of their endeavors.

Accountability and Responsibility: The practice of integrity encompasses accountability for one’s actions. Individuals with integrity take responsibility for their decisions and their consequences, reinforcing the idea that ethical behavior is not just a choice but an obligation.

Moral Growth and Self-Respect: Upholding integrity requires individuals to confront ethical dilemmas and make principled choices. This process of moral introspection and growth not only strengthens one’s character but also fosters self-respect and a sense of moral accomplishment.

Conflict Resolution and Mediation: In disputes and conflicts, individuals with integrity often serve as mediators or facilitators. Their impartiality, trustworthiness, and commitment to fairness make them well-suited to navigate and resolve contentious issues.

Building a Just Society: On a broader scale, integrity plays a pivotal role in building a just and equitable society. It underpins the principles of fairness, honesty, and accountability in institutions, governance, and the legal system, contributing to social cohesion and stability.

Enhancing Organizational Reputation: In the business world, integrity is closely tied to an organization’s reputation. Companies that prioritize ethical conduct and integrity not only earn the trust of their customers but also attract top talent and foster a positive work culture.

Promoting Transparency: Integrity promotes transparency in governance and decision-making processes. It discourages corruption, cronyism, and favoritism, ensuring that public and private institutions operate with fairness and equity.

Inspiration and Role Modeling: Individuals with integrity often serve as sources of inspiration and role models for others. Their commitment to ethical behavior sets a standard that encourages others to emulate their principles.

What is Integrity?

The word integrity has evolved from the Latin word integer which means “complete” or “whole”. This suggests that for achieving integrity, something has to be whole and undivided. It refers to the concept of living by one’s values and principles. The current conceptualization of integrity is the combination of consistency in words and actions with adherence to morality and values in the actions. Living with integrity means being true and authentic to our code of beliefs or worldview.

Integrity in Business

At the corporate level, integrity refers to a willingness to stick to certain policies, ethics, and leadership philosophy. Organisations with high integrity are characterised as organisations that are collaborative, constructive, innovative, transparent, and with high employee morale. They build great teams and create value. Studies have shown that corporations with a culture of integrity tend to have higher-quality of earnings. They tend to be good places to work, competitive in markets, and provide higher, more predictable returns.

Examples of Integrity

There are various examples of integrity in real life. Let’s take the life story of our great leader Mahatma Gandhi who lived his life with integrity. He followed the path of truth and non-violence throughout his life. He called off the Non-Cooperation movement to maintain integrity with his principle of non-violence. He did not compromise with integrity even though many people were against his decision to cancel the Non- Cooperation movement at the national level. He opted to follow the path of truth and integrity even in the most testing times.

Integrity helps a person to be honest, loyal and committed to his work. One of the real-life examples is Mr. Ashok Khemka. He was an IAS officer of the 1991 batch. He was in the Haryana Cadre and was transferred fifty-one times in his 24 years of Civil Service career. He was awarded for his effort in exposing corruption at the highest level. He got S. R. Jindal Prize in 2011 for ‘his crusade against corruption’.

Living with integrity doesn’t guarantee success or fame. But people are certainly far more likely to feel passionate about their work. They can tackle challenges with energy and fortitude. They can easily inculcate integrity in their nature if their actions are in line with their values and beliefs, and their efforts are directed toward something they truly believe in.
